Understanding Box Truck Accident Cases

Common Causes

  • Limited rear visibility due to the enclosed cargo area
  • Drivers unfamiliar with the truck size hitting overpasses or low clearances
  • Improperly loaded cargo shifting and causing loss of control
  • Inexperienced drivers operating commercial vehicles without adequate CDL training
  • Tight delivery schedules leading to aggressive driving behavior
  • Rollover accidents caused by top heavy loads on curves

Typical Injuries

  • Crush injuries from the truck weight and size
  • Head and neck injuries from high impact collisions
  • Broken bones including ribs, pelvis, and extremities
  • Soft tissue injuries and severe bruising
  • Lacerations from cargo debris
  • Spinal injuries and chronic back pain

Establishing Liability

Box truck operators and their employers can be held liable when accidents result from negligent hiring, poor vehicle maintenance, or failure to train drivers properly. Companies that rent box trucks to the public may also face claims if they fail to screen drivers or provide safety instructions. Evidence from onboard GPS tracking, maintenance logs, and driver qualification files can be used to establish negligence.

Relevant Texas Law

Box trucks between 10,001 and 26,000 pounds fall under Texas commercial vehicle regulations but may not require a commercial driver license depending on their configuration. Texas Transportation Code Chapter 621 governs vehicle size and weight requirements that apply to box trucks operating on Texas roads. Employers of box truck drivers can be held vicariously liable under Texas respondeat superior principles when the driver was acting within the course and scope of employment.

Local Resources and Courts in Dallas

George L. Allen Sr. Courts Building, 600 Commerce St, Dallas, TX 75202

Personal injury civil cases in Dallas are filed in the Dallas County District Courts. Dallas County has numerous district courts handling civil matters, housed primarily at the George Allen Courts Building in downtown Dallas.
